Comfort Seoul Overview

You know what struck me most about Comfort Seoul when I first walked in? It’s one of those places that just gets the basics absolutely right without trying to be something it’s not. I mean, sure, it’s a 3-star property, but honestly – sometimes that’s exactly what you want in a city like Seoul where you’re going to be out exploring most of the time anyway.

The thing is, this place has that rare quality where everything actually works the way it should. The shower pressure is solid (and trust me, after walking around Seoul’s hills all day, you’ll appreciate that), the WiFi doesn’t cut out every five minutes, and the beds are genuinely comfortable – not just hotel-brochure comfortable. I’ve stayed in plenty of places that promised more and delivered way less. The staff here really knows their stuff too, and I noticed they’re quick to help with subway directions or restaurant recommendations without that scripted feel you get at some places. Actually, one of the front desk guys gave me this insider tip about a late-night Korean BBQ spot that I never would’ve found otherwise.

What I really appreciate is how the hotel sits in the city – you’re not stuck way out in some business district where everything shuts down after 6 PM. The neighborhood has that authentic Seoul energy, with convenience stores on every corner (seriously, the 7-Eleven downstairs became my best friend), and you can actually hear the city humming without it being obnoxiously loud at night. I slept fine, which is saying something because I’m usually sensitive to street noise. The rooms themselves are clean and well-maintained, nothing fancy but everything you need is there and it all works properly. Honestly, the attention to detail shows – like how they’ve actually thought about outlet placement so you can charge your phone next to the bed, or how the curtains actually block out light instead of just being decorative. It’s those little things that make you realize someone who actually travels had input on the design. The housekeeping is thorough too, which matters more than people think when you’re unpacking and repacking every few days. Look, if you’re looking for a rooftop pool or a spa, this isn’t your place – but if you want somewhere reliable, well-located, and honestly priced where you can recharge between adventures in one of Asia’s most exciting cities, Comfort Seoul delivers exactly what it promises.

Surroundings

What’s nearby:

  • Nakseongdae: 2.4 km
  • Banpo Bridge: 6 km
  • Dongjak Bridge: 4.2 km
  • Seoul Arts Center: 3.5 km
  • Banpo Hangang Park: 5 km
  • Gangnam Finance Center: 6 km
  • Gwacheon National Science Museum: 6 km
  • Gwanaksan Park Outdoor Botanical Garden: 4.7 km
  • Seoul National University Museum of Art: 3.8 km
  • The Korean Christian Museum at Soongsil University: 3 km

Public transport:

  • Train Isu: 1.2 km
  • Metro Sadang: 550 m
  • Train Namseong: 1.1 km
  • Metro Isu Station: 1.2 km

Closest airports:

  • Gimpo International Airport: 20 km
  • Incheon International Airport: 60 km

House Rules at Comfort Seoul

Pets:

  • Pets are not allowed.

Parties:

  • Parties/events are not allowed

Smoking:

  • Smoking is not allowed.

Check-in:

  • From 15:00
  • You’ll need to let the property know in advance what time you’ll arrive.

Check-out:

  • Until 11:00

No age restriction:

  • There is no age requirement for check-in
